Sariba The manual process produces a very low quantity whereas the mechanical process is a fast process done with a banana fiber extraction machine. The mechanical properties of Banana bark fibers are: tensile strength 381MPa, strain at the break 2.1% (Jiyas N, DrBinduKumar K, Mathew John, et al., 2016).
